Conjunctival nevus, also nevus of the conjunctiva, is a benign melanocytic lesion.
General
- Common.
- Generally benign.[1]
Microscopic
Features:
- Benign melanocytic proliferation.
DDx:
- Conjunctival malignant melanoma.
- Other melanocytic lesions.
